American States Water (NYSE:AWR) Shares Sold by Point72 Asia Singapore Pte. Ltd.

Point72 Asia Singapore Pte. Ltd. trimmed its holdings in American States Water (NYSE:AWRFree Report) by 61.1% in the second qu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The fund owned 934 shares of the utilities provider’s stock after selling 1,470 shares during the period. Point72 Asia Singapore Pte. Ltd.’s holdings in American States Water were worth $68,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ission.

American States Water Price Performance

Shares of NYSE:AWR opened at $83.78 on Friday. The company has a quick ratio of 0.64, a current ratio of 0.70 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.92. The company has a 50-day moving average price of $82.31 and a 200 day moving average price of $76.18. American States Water has a 52 week low of $66.03 and a 52 week high of $85.71. The company has a market cap of $3.14 billion, a P/E ratio of 27.38, a PEG ratio of 4.42 and a beta of 0.49.

American States Water (NYSE:AWRG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, August 6th. The utilities provider reported $0.85 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.87 by ($0.02). American States Water had a return on equity of 13.45% and a net margin of 18.85%. The business had revenue of $155.30 million during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$138.00 million. During the same quarter in the previous year, the company posted $0.83 EPS. The company’s revenue was down 1.3% compared to the same quarter last year. Research analysts predict that American States Water will post 3.03 earnings per share for the current year.

American States Water Increases Dividend

The business also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Tuesday, September 3rd. Investors of record on Friday, August 16th were issued a dividend of $0.4655 per share.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Friday, August 16th. This represents a $1.86 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 2.22%. This is an increase from American States Water’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.43. American States Water’s payout ratio is currently 60.78%.

American States Water Profile

(Free Report)

American States Water Company, through its subsidiaries, provides water and electric services to residential, commercial, industrial, and other customers in the United States. It operates through three segments: Water, Electric, and Contracted Services. The company purchases, produces, distributes, and sells water, as well as distributes electricity.
